Abstract
The invention discloses a low-concentration NAA and glycerogel root-dipping method, and belongs to the technical field of plant biology. The method comprises the steps that a 1 mg/mL NAA mother solution is prepared; the mother solution is diluted into a 10 mg/L low-concentration NAA working solution; low-concentration NAA and glycerogel confining liquid with the mass concentration of sodium carboxymethyl cellulose equal to 1% and the mass concentration of sodium alginate equal to 8% is prepared through the working solution; the lower ends of healthy and thick branches are dipped in the gel confining liquid for 3-5 seconds and taken out; the branches are inserted into a culture medium for rooting.

embodiment:
Below in conjunction with specific embodiment, the present invention is conducted further description.
Embodiment
Low concentration NAA and glycerogel be stained with a method for root, it is characterized in that, include hormone mother liquor, working solution preparation, the preparation of hormone gel in the described method of institute, be stained with root, cuttage, concrete operation step is as follows:
1. hormone mother liquor: precise weight be 0.1g NAA with a little 95% ethanol dissolve after, be settled to 100mL with distilled water, be the NAA mother liquor of 1mg/mL;
2. working solution preparation: above-mentioned mother liquor is diluted to according to the ratio of volume ratio 1:100 the low concentration hormone working solution that concentration is 10mg/L, simultaneously add 10ml glycerine according to 90ml hormone working solution;
3. hormone gel preparation: accurately take 1g sodium carboxymethylcellulose and 8g sodium alginate is that the hormone of 10mg/L and glycerine working solution dissolve for subsequent use by the concentration of 100mL under 50 DEG C of water bath condition;
be stained with root: 8-10cm is long, healthy sturdy Chinese littleleaf box branch lower end sticks in 3-5 in above-mentioned gel confining liquid and takes out after second;
cuttage: inserted in cultivation matrix by above-mentioned branch and take root, after 30-40 days, rooting rate reaches more than 75%.
